Cita:
Empezado por sierraja
Ok de hecho una de mis pruebas fue asi de sencilla y lo hizo muy bien, pero el problema consiste en que antes del year 2009 no se tenia impuesto en esas facturas y por lo tanto se deberia colocar.
|
El truco está en meter las condiciones del WHERE (como la del año 2009), una a una, así llegas a saber sin la menor duda cual es la cláusula que ocasiona el conflicto, y con ello es muchísimo más fácil de solucionar.
Aunque Casimiro tiene toda la razón en que va a ser mucho más rápido detectar el conflicto dentro de la cláusula WHERE utilizando sentencias SELECT y no UPDATES.
Saludos.